Constraints on narrow exotic states from K+p and KL0p scattering data

Description
We consider the effect of exotic S = + 1 resonances Θ+ and Θ++ on K+p elastic scattering data (total cross section) and the process KL0p → KS0p. Data near the observed Θ+ (1540) are examined for evidence of additional states. The width limit for a Θ++ state is reconsidered
